Salt Home Decor: Tips for Creating a Cozy and Inviting Space

Salt home decor, inspired by the serene and soothing qualities of coastal and rustic aesthetics, has become a popular trend in interior design. This style emphasizes natural materials, soft color palettes, and a sense of calm and relaxation. Whether you live near the coast or just love the tranquil vibes of seaside living, incorporating salt home decor into your space can create a cozy and inviting environment. Here are some tips to help you achieve this serene aesthetic in your home.

Embrace a Neutral Color Palette

A neutral color palette is fundamental to salt home decor. Shades of white, beige, soft blues, and grays evoke the tranquility of the seaside and provide a calm and serene backdrop.

  1. Walls and Ceilings:
    • Paint walls and ceilings in light, airy colors such as soft white or pale blue to create an open and spacious feel.
    • Use different shades of the same color to add depth and interest without overwhelming the space.
  2. Furniture:
    • Choose furniture in neutral tones like beige, gray, or white. Natural wood finishes also work well, adding warmth and a touch of rustic charm.
    • Upholstery in light fabrics such as linen or cotton enhances the relaxed vibe.
  3. Accents:
    • Incorporate accent colors through throw pillows, rugs, and artwork. Soft pastels like seafoam green, blush pink, or lavender can add subtle pops of color.

Incorporate Natural Materials

Natural materials are key to creating an authentic salt home decor look. They bring the outside in, adding texture and a sense of organic beauty.

  1. Wood:
    • Use reclaimed wood or driftwood for furniture, shelving, and decorative accents. The weathered look of these materials adds character and a coastal feel.
    • Consider wooden floors, exposed beams, or wood-paneled walls for a rustic touch.
  2. Stone:
    • Incorporate stone elements like a fireplace, countertops, or stone-tiled floors. Natural stone adds an earthy and timeless quality to the space.
    • Use pebbles or stone decorations in bathrooms or outdoor areas to enhance the coastal vibe.
  3. Textiles:
    • Opt for natural fibers such as linen, cotton, and wool for curtains, upholstery, and rugs. These materials add softness and comfort.
    • Layer different textures with throws, cushions, and rugs to create a cozy and inviting atmosphere.

Create a Sense of Light and Airiness

Salt home decor thrives on light and airy spaces. Maximizing natural light and using light fixtures that complement the serene aesthetic can make a significant difference.

  1. Windows:
    • Keep window treatments light and breezy. Sheer curtains or shades in light colors allow natural light to filter through while maintaining privacy.
    • Avoid heavy drapes or dark blinds that can block light and make the space feel closed in.
  2. Lighting:
    • Use a mix of ambient, task, and accent lighting to create a well-lit space. Pendant lights, floor lamps, and table lamps in natural materials like rattan, bamboo, or glass are ideal.
    • Consider adding dimmer switches to adjust lighting levels and create a cozy atmosphere in the evenings.
  3. Mirrors:
    • Strategically place mirrors to reflect light and make the space feel larger. A large mirror with a driftwood frame can be a beautiful focal point.

Add Coastal and Nautical Accents

Coastal and nautical accents can bring the salt home decor theme to life, evoking the feeling of being by the sea.

  1. Decorative Items:
    • Use items like seashells, coral, starfish, and driftwood as decorative accents. Display them in glass jars, bowls, or as part of a centerpiece.
    • Nautical-themed items such as lanterns, ropes, and anchors can add subtle hints of the seaside without overwhelming the decor.
  2. Artwork:
    • Hang artwork that reflects coastal landscapes, seascapes, or nautical themes. Watercolor paintings, prints, or photographs can enhance the serene ambiance.
    • Consider creating a gallery wall with a mix of coastal-themed art and personal photographs.
  3. Textiles and Patterns:
    • Use textiles with coastal-inspired patterns such as stripes, chevrons, or botanical prints. These can be incorporated through cushions, throws, and rugs.
    • A striped rug or nautical-themed throw pillows can add a touch of the seaside to your living room or bedroom.

Emphasize Comfort and Relaxation

Creating a cozy and inviting space means prioritizing comfort. Every element of your decor should contribute to a relaxing and welcoming environment.

  1. Furniture Layout:
    • Arrange furniture to encourage conversation and relaxation. Create cozy seating areas with comfortable chairs and sofas.
    • Add an inviting reading nook with a comfy chair, a soft throw, and a good lamp.
  2. Soft Furnishings:
    • Layer soft furnishings like cushions, throws, and rugs to add warmth and comfort. Choose items in soft, tactile fabrics that invite you to sit back and relax.
    • Consider adding floor cushions or poufs for additional casual seating.
  3. Personal Touches:
    • Incorporate personal items that reflect your interests and memories. Family photos, travel souvenirs, and cherished heirlooms can make the space feel uniquely yours.
    • Displaying items that have sentimental value can add warmth and a sense of belonging to your home.

Maintain a Clutter-Free Environment

A key aspect of salt home decor is maintaining a clutter-free environment. This helps to enhance the sense of calm and relaxation.

  1. Storage Solutions:
    • Use stylish storage solutions like woven baskets, wooden crates, or built-in shelving to keep items organized and out of sight.
    • Opt for furniture with built-in storage, such as ottomans, coffee tables with drawers, or benches with hidden compartments.
  2. Minimalist Approach:
    • Embrace a minimalist approach to decor, choosing quality over quantity. Select a few statement pieces and keep surfaces clear of unnecessary items.
    • Regularly declutter and reassess your belongings to ensure the space remains tidy and serene.
